Abstract
本实用新型涉及发酵装置技术领域,尤其是一种动植物废弃物发酵装置;包括发酵池,所述发酵池的边上有搅拌装置,所述发酵池内有固液分离装置,所述固液分离装置通过固定框发酵池连接,固液分离装置与固定框之间通过升降杆连接,所述发酵池的上方有活动盖体,所述活动盖体与发酵池之间有密封圈,所述活动盖体上有换气口,所述换气口与换气管连接,所述发酵池的上方还有进料装置,所述发酵池的底部有出液口;本实用新型的废弃物发酵装置结构简单,设计合理,发酵条件易于调节,生产效率高。
The utility model relates to the technical field of fermenting devices, in particular to a fermenting device for animal and plant waste; comprising a fermenting tank, a stirring device is arranged on the edge of the fermenting tank, a solid-liquid separation device is arranged in the fermenting tank, and the solid-liquid separation The device is connected through a fixed frame fermentation tank, and the solid-liquid separation device is connected with the fixed frame through a lifting rod. There is a movable cover above the fermentation tank, and there is a sealing ring between the movable cover and the fermentation tank. The movable cover There is a ventilation port on the body, the ventilation port is connected with the ventilation pipe, there is a feeding device above the fermentation tank, and there is a liquid outlet at the bottom of the fermentation tank; the waste fermentation device of the utility model has a simple structure , the design is reasonable, the fermentation conditions are easy to adjust, and the production efficiency is high.
Description
技术领域technical field
本实用新型涉及发酵装置技术领域,尤其是一种动植物废弃物发酵装置。The utility model relates to the technical field of fermentation devices, in particular to a fermentation device for animal and plant waste.
背景技术Background technique
随着工农业生产的进行,每天都会产生大量的动植物废弃物,诸如饲养生猪机蛋鸡或肉鸡产生的猪粪和鸡粪,以及种植农作物产生的废弃的果蔬秧苗和秸秆等,这些废弃物若得不到合理处理的话,会对环境造成很大破坏,也会带来很大的资源浪费。目前市场上还没有合适的动植物废弃物的发酵装置。With the progress of industrial and agricultural production, a large amount of animal and plant waste is produced every day, such as pig manure and chicken manure produced by raising mechanical layer hens or broiler chickens, and discarded fruit and vegetable seedlings and straw produced by planting crops. If it is not treated properly, it will cause great damage to the environment and cause a lot of waste of resources. At present, there is no suitable fermentation device for animal and plant waste in the market.
发明内容Contents of the invention
本发明的目的是:提供一种结构简单、设计合理,可以调节发酵条件的动植物废弃物发酵装置。The purpose of the present invention is to provide an animal and plant waste fermentation device with simple structure, reasonable design and adjustable fermentation conditions.
为解决上述技术问题,本发明采用的技术方案如下:In order to solve the problems of the technologies described above, the technical scheme adopted in the present invention is as follows:
一种动植物废弃物发酵装置,包括发酵池,所述发酵池的边上有搅拌装置,所述搅拌装置包括基座,所述基座上有立杆,所述立杆与活动臂连接,所述活动臂上连接有搅拌桨,A fermenting device for animal and plant waste, comprising a fermentation vat, a stirring device is provided on the side of the fermenting vat, and the agitating device includes a base, and a vertical pole is arranged on the base, and the vertical pole is connected with a movable arm, A stirring paddle is connected to the movable arm,
所述发酵池内有固液分离装置,所述固液分离装置通过固定框发酵池连接,固液分离装置与固定框之间通过升降杆连接,There is a solid-liquid separation device in the fermentation tank, and the solid-liquid separation device is connected to the fermentation tank through a fixed frame, and the solid-liquid separation device is connected to the fixed frame through a lifting rod.
所述发酵池的上方有活动盖体,所述活动盖体与发酵池之间有密封圈,所述活动盖体上有换气口,所述换气口与换气管连接,There is a movable cover above the fermentation tank, a sealing ring is arranged between the movable cover and the fermentation tank, there is a ventilation port on the movable cover, and the ventilation port is connected with a ventilation pipe,
所述发酵池的上方还有进料装置,所述发酵池的底部有出液口。There is also a feeding device above the fermentation tank, and a liquid outlet is provided at the bottom of the fermentation tank.
优选的,所述立杆与活动臂之间通过轴销连接,立杆与活动臂之间还通过气缸连接,所述活动臂远离立杆的一端连接有搅拌桨。Preferably, the vertical rod and the movable arm are connected by a pivot pin, and the vertical rod and the movable arm are also connected by a cylinder, and the end of the movable arm away from the vertical rod is connected with a stirring paddle.
优选的,所述搅拌桨包括铁框,所述铁框内安装有若干搅拌板,所述搅拌板上开有通孔,所述搅拌板与铁框之间的夹角为45-60°。Preferably, the stirring paddle includes an iron frame, a plurality of stirring plates are installed in the iron frame, through holes are opened on the stirring plates, and the included angle between the stirring plates and the iron frame is 45-60°.
优选的,所述换气管包括进气管和出气管,所述进气管与鼓风机连接,所述出气管伸入水洗池中,所述出气管上有一段粗管段,粗管段位于发酵池与水洗池之间。Preferably, the air exchange pipe includes an air inlet pipe and an air outlet pipe, the air inlet pipe is connected to the blower, the air outlet pipe extends into the washing tank, and there is a thick pipe section on the air outlet pipe, and the thick pipe section is located between the fermentation tank and the water washing tank between.
优选的,所述固液分离装置包括过滤框,过滤框内有过滤网,固定框与过滤网的四边通过环扣连接。Preferably, the solid-liquid separation device includes a filter frame with a filter screen inside, and the fixed frame is connected to the four sides of the filter screen through rings.
优选的,所述固定框位于发酵池的边上,固定框包括固定架和连接杆,固定架通过连接杆与发酵池连接,固定架与连接杆之间通过螺纹连接。Preferably, the fixed frame is located on the edge of the fermentation tank, the fixed frame includes a fixed frame and a connecting rod, the fixed frame is connected to the fermentation tank through the connecting rod, and the fixed frame and the connecting rod are connected by threads.
优选的,所述发酵池的内壁上还有温度传感器,发酵池与活动盖体之间还有压力传感器,所述压力传感器位于发酵池的内壁上。Preferably, there is a temperature sensor on the inner wall of the fermentation tank, and a pressure sensor between the fermentation tank and the movable cover, and the pressure sensor is located on the inner wall of the fermentation tank.
采用本发明的技术方案的有益效果是:The beneficial effects of adopting the technical solution of the present invention are:
1、本实用新型中固液分离装置包括过滤框,过滤框内有过滤网,固定框与过滤网的四边通过环扣连接,在过滤框内设置过滤网,可以对过滤网进行有效的保护,延长过滤网的使用寿命,降低使用成本;1. The solid-liquid separation device in the utility model includes a filter frame, and there is a filter screen in the filter frame. The four sides of the fixed frame and the filter screen are connected by buckles, and the filter screen is set in the filter frame, which can effectively protect the filter screen. Extend the service life of the filter and reduce the cost of use;
2、本实用新型中搅拌桨包括铁框,铁框内安装有若干搅拌板,搅拌板上开有通孔,搅拌板与铁框之间的夹角为45-60°,搅拌桨采用铁框和搅拌板,一方面,提高了搅拌桨与物料的接触面积,从而提高了搅拌效率,另一方面,搅拌板与铁框之间有夹角的安装,又可以有效减少搅拌桨与物料之间的搅拌面积,降低搅拌阻力,提高操作效率,搅拌板上设有通孔,搅拌过程中发酵液可以透过通孔,从而大大降低了搅拌阻力,降低了操作能耗;2. The stirring paddle in the utility model includes an iron frame, and several stirring plates are installed in the iron frame. There are through holes on the stirring plate. The angle between the stirring plate and the iron frame is 45-60°. The stirring paddle adopts an iron frame And the stirring plate, on the one hand, it increases the contact area between the stirring paddle and the material, thus improving the stirring efficiency; on the other hand, the installation with an included angle between the stirring plate and the iron frame can effectively reduce the The stirring area is large, the stirring resistance is reduced, and the operating efficiency is improved. There are through holes on the stirring plate, and the fermentation liquid can pass through the through holes during the stirring process, thereby greatly reducing the stirring resistance and reducing the energy consumption of the operation;
3、本实用新型的废弃物发酵装置结构简单,设计合理,发酵条件易于调节,生产效率高。3. The waste fermentation device of the utility model has simple structure, reasonable design, easy adjustment of fermentation conditions and high production efficiency.

具体实施方式Detailed ways
现在结合附图对本发明作进一步详细的说明。这些附图均为简化的示意图,仅以示意方式说明本发明的基本结构,因此其仅显示与本发明有关的构成。The present invention is described in further detail now in conjunction with accompanying drawing. These drawings are all simplified schematic diagrams, which only illustrate the basic structure of the present invention in a schematic manner, so they only show the configurations related to the present invention.
如图1所示,一种动植物废弃物发酵装置,包括发酵池1,发酵池1的周围有一圈池边,发酵池1的边上有搅拌装置,搅拌装置包括基座2,基座2通过钢钉固定在发酵池1的边上,基座2上有立杆3,立杆3与基座2接触的一端有连接板,连接板与基座2之间通过钢钉以及螺栓连接,从而将立杆3稳定的固定在发酵池1的边上,立杆3与活动臂4连接,立杆3与活动臂4之间通过轴销连接,立杆3与活动臂4之间还通过气缸10连接,活动臂4远离立杆3的一端连接有搅拌桨,活动臂4包括第一活动臂和第二活动臂,第一活动臂与立杆3之间通过轴销连接,第一活动臂与立杆3之间还通过固定杆连接,第一活动臂与第二活动臂之间通过气缸10连接,第二活动臂远离第一活动臂的一端连接有搅拌桨,需要搅拌时,气缸10带动第二活动臂上下或左右移动,从而带动搅拌桨对发酵池1内的发酵物进行充分搅拌,从而确保发酵池1中的发酵物进行充分发酵;As shown in Figure 1, a kind of animal and plant waste fermenting device comprises fermenting tank 1, and there is a pool edge around fermenting tank 1, and there is stirring device on the edge of fermenting tank 1, and stirring device comprises base 2, base 2 It is fixed on the side of the fermentation tank 1 by steel nails. There is a vertical pole 3 on the base 2. There is a connecting plate at the end of the vertical pole 3 in contact with the base 2. The connecting plate and the base 2 are connected by steel nails and bolts. Thereby the vertical rod 3 is stably fixed on the edge of the fermentation tank 1, the vertical rod 3 is connected with the movable arm 4, the vertical rod 3 and the movable arm 4 are connected by pivot pins, and the vertical rod 3 and the movable arm 4 are also passed through Cylinder 10 is connected, movable arm 4 is connected with stirring paddle far away from one end of vertical rod 3, movable arm 4 comprises first movable arm and second movable arm, is connected by pivot pin between the first movable arm and vertical rod 3, the first movable Also be connected by fixed rod between arm and vertical bar 3, be connected by cylinder 10 between the first movable arm and the second movable arm, the second movable arm is connected with stirring paddle far away from the end of the first movable arm, when need stirring, cylinder 10 Drive the second movable arm to move up and down or left and right, thereby driving the stirring paddle to fully stir the fermented product in the fermentation tank 1, thereby ensuring that the fermented product in the fermentation tank 1 is fully fermented;
发酵池1内有固液分离装置17,固液分离装置17用于对发酵池1中的发酵物进行固液分离,从而根据实际需要收集发酵后的固体物料或发酵液,固液分离装置17通过固定框与发酵池1连接,固液分离装置17与固定框之间通过升降杆连接,固定框包括固定架18和连接杆19,固定架18通过连接杆19与发酵池1连接,固定框18与连接杆19之间通过螺纹连接,本实施例中连接杆19包括第一连接杆和第二连接杆,第一连接杆和第二连接杆之间通过气缸连接,第一连接杆与固定框之间通过螺纹连接,固定框安装在发酵池1的上方,连接杆为升降杆,通过升降杆可以调节固液分离装置17的高度,从而对发酵物进行固液分离操作,通过升降杆调节固液分离装置17的高度,操作更方便,升降杆采用气缸或液压缸之间的一种;发酵池1的上方有活动盖体6,活动盖体6采用橡胶或硬质塑料制成,往发酵池1中添加物料时,打开盖体,物料添加结束,合上盖体,活动盖体6的结构设计,操作方便,而且活动盖体6与发酵池1之间有密封圈7,密封圈7的结构设计,提高了发酵池1内的密封性,给物料发酵提供了良好的发酵环境,活动盖体6上有换气口,换气口与换气管连接,换气管包括进气管13和出气管14,进气管13与鼓风机连接,可以根据实际的发酵条件对发酵池1内的含氧量进行调节,调节方便,出气管14伸入水洗池15中,出气管14上有一段粗管段16,粗管段16位于发酵池1与水洗池15之间,粗管段16的结构设计,可以避免水洗池15内的液体发生倒吸进入到发酵池1内,影响发酵的正常进行,发酵池1的上方还有进料装置,进料装置包括进料口和进料管,进料管内有螺旋输送辊,采用螺旋输送辊输送物料,效率高,进料装置安装在一可以移动的安装座上,使用更方便,发酵池1的底部有出液口8,发酵池1内的发酵液通过出液口8排出,本实施例中发酵池1的底部有安装支架20,通过安装支架20将发酵池1固定在地面上,一方面,安装稳定,另一方面,使用更方便。There is a solid-liquid separation device 17 in the fermentation tank 1. The solid-liquid separation device 17 is used for solid-liquid separation of the fermented product in the fermentation tank 1, so as to collect the fermented solid material or fermentation liquid according to actual needs. The solid-liquid separation device 17 The fixed frame is connected with the fermentation tank 1, and the solid-liquid separation device 17 is connected with the fixed frame through a lifting rod. The fixed frame includes a fixed frame 18 and a connecting rod 19. The fixed frame 18 is connected with the fermentation tank 1 through a connecting rod 19. The fixed frame 18 and the connecting rod 19 are threadedly connected. In the present embodiment, the connecting rod 19 includes a first connecting rod and a second connecting rod, and the first connecting rod and the second connecting rod are connected by a cylinder. The first connecting rod and the fixed The frames are connected by threads, and the fixed frame is installed above the fermentation tank 1. The connecting rod is a lifting rod, and the height of the solid-liquid separation device 17 can be adjusted through the lifting rod, so as to perform solid-liquid separation operation on the fermented product. The height of the solid-liquid separation device 17 is more convenient to operate. The lifting rod adopts a kind of cylinder or hydraulic cylinder; there is a movable cover 6 on the top of the fermentation tank 1, and the movable cover 6 is made of rubber or hard plastic. When adding materials in the fermentation tank 1, open the cover body, close the cover body after the material addition is completed, the structural design of the movable cover body 6 is easy to operate, and there is a sealing ring 7 between the movable cover body 6 and the fermentation tank 1, the sealing ring The structural design of 7 improves the sealing in the fermentation tank 1 and provides a good fermentation environment for material fermentation. There is a ventilating port on the movable cover 6, and the venting port is connected to the ventilating pipe. The ventilating pipe includes the air intake pipe 13 and The air outlet pipe 14 and the air inlet pipe 13 are connected with the blower, and the oxygen content in the fermentation tank 1 can be adjusted according to the actual fermentation conditions. 16. The thick tube section 16 is located between the fermentation tank 1 and the washing tank 15. The structural design of the thick tube section 16 can prevent the liquid in the washing tank 15 from being sucked back into the fermentation tank 1, which will affect the normal progress of fermentation. The fermentation tank 1 There is also a feeding device above the feeder. The feeding device includes a feeding port and a feeding pipe. There is a screw conveying roller in the feeding pipe. The spiral conveying roller is used to convey the material, which has high efficiency. The feeding device is installed on a movable mounting base. , it is more convenient to use. The bottom of the fermentation tank 1 has a liquid outlet 8, and the fermentation liquid in the fermentation tank 1 is discharged through the liquid outlet 8. In this embodiment, the bottom of the fermentation tank 1 has a mounting bracket 20, through which the fermentation tank 20 will be fermented. The pool 1 is fixed on the ground, on the one hand, the installation is stable, and on the other hand, it is more convenient to use.
本实施例中搅拌桨包括铁框5,铁框5内安装有若干搅拌板11,搅拌板11上开有通孔12,搅拌板11与铁框5之间的夹角为45-60°,搅拌桨采用铁框5和搅拌板11,一方面,提高了搅拌桨与物料的接触面积,从而提高了搅拌效率,另一方面,搅拌板11与铁框5之间有夹角的安装,又可以有效减少搅拌桨与物料之间的搅拌面积,降低搅拌阻力,提高操作效率,搅拌板11上设有通孔12,搅拌过程中发酵液可以透过通孔,从而大大降低了搅拌阻力,降低了操作能耗。In the present embodiment, the stirring paddle comprises an iron frame 5, a number of stirring plates 11 are installed in the iron frame 5, and a through hole 12 is provided on the stirring plate 11, and the included angle between the stirring plate 11 and the iron frame 5 is 45-60°, The stirring paddle adopts the iron frame 5 and the stirring plate 11. On the one hand, the contact area between the stirring paddle and the material is increased, thereby improving the stirring efficiency; It can effectively reduce the stirring area between the stirring paddle and the material, reduce the stirring resistance, and improve the operating efficiency. The stirring plate 11 is provided with a through hole 12, and the fermentation liquid can pass through the through hole during the stirring process, thereby greatly reducing the stirring resistance and reducing the operating energy consumption.
本实施例中固液分离装置17包括过滤框,过滤框内有过滤网,固定框与过滤网的四边通过环扣连接,在过滤框内设置过滤网,可以对过滤网进行有效的保护,延长过滤网的使用寿命,降低使用成本。In the present embodiment, the solid-liquid separation device 17 includes a filter frame, and a filter screen is arranged in the filter frame, and the four sides of the fixed frame and the filter screen are connected by rings, and the filter screen is set in the filter frame, which can effectively protect the filter screen and extend the life of the filter screen. The service life of the filter net is reduced, and the cost of use is reduced.
本实施例中发酵池1的内壁上还有温度传感器,发酵池1与活动盖体6之间还有压力传感器,压力传感器位于发酵池1的内壁上,通过温度传感器和压力传感器检测发酵池1内的压力,可以提高发酵过程的安全性。In this embodiment, there is also a temperature sensor on the inner wall of the fermentation tank 1, and a pressure sensor between the fermentation tank 1 and the movable cover 6. The internal pressure can improve the safety of the fermentation process.
